CMs - how much expense-wise do you allow for meals and snacks?

6 replies

LingDiLongMerrilyonHigh · 19/12/2012 22:07

Did you price up a few meals, every meal or do you just guestimate? I think I need to be allowing more, I've just kind of guessed it so far.

lechatnoir · 19/12/2012 22:46

I allow 50p/ breakfast, £1.25/lunch & £2.25 per dinner and 50p per snack so £4.50 for a full day which sounds a lot but I spend a small fortune on fruit & veg so don't think it's OTT.

I have calculated breakfast & lunches properly (ie 1 weetabix, 1/4 pint of milk, 1/8 carton of fruit juice etc) but not mustered the energy or enthusiasm to do dinners so be interested to hear other responses. Wink

HSMM · 20/12/2012 07:36

I allow £3 per day for lunch and snacks. I worked it out over a period of time and then chose a figure below average, so HMRC can't argue with it. Depends what you feed them really.

Runoutofideas · 20/12/2012 07:52

I go for £2 per meal incl dessert. Don't take off extra for snacks - although maybe I should as we get through half a tonne of fruit!

glentherednosedbattleostrich · 20/12/2012 07:59

I worked it out at about £4.50 per day per child for breakfast, lunch, tea and snacks. However, one of my children is gluten free so that pushes the costs up a little as we have to get gluten free biscuits and snacks and flour for baking etc.

ZuleikaD · 20/12/2012 14:05

I allow £4 per day, but as I've normally got very young toddlers they don't eat masses.
